Were you a NCO before you reclassed? If so what is the transition like being in a leadership position fresh out of AIT? I have your email address, mind if I hit you up with a few more questions on AKO?
I certainly do not mind whatsoever.

As far as your first question, I was an NCO when I reclassed. I'm not going to lie...it was not an easy transition because you are expected to know an awful lot of stuff and run teams, and detention facilities etc. It was very rewarding though and if you put your mind to it, it isn't as difficult as it seems at first.

If you have combat experience as I did your soldiers will value your experience and leadership should you provide it.
